A total of 787 foreign nationals in irregular migratory status were detained, while 790 individuals were deported in accordance with current legal procedures. The operations took place in Greater Santo Domingo, the eastern, northern, and southern regions of the country, as well as at key border areas including El\u00edas Pi\u00f1a, Jiman\u00ed, and Pedernales. The DGM specified that 153 foreign nationals were handed over to migration authorities by security forces. Of those, 67 were transferred by the Dominican Army and 47 by Cuerpo Especializado en Seguridad Fronteriza Terrestre (CESFRONT). Deportations were carried out through control posts located in Dajab\u00f3n, El\u00edas Pi\u00f1a, Jiman\u00ed, and Pedernales. According to the authorities, these operations form part of a broader effort to strengthen migration control measures nationwide.
